Description
1991
Etching, on Meirat Velasquez and Japanese Kozo paper, the full sheet.
S. 34 5/8 x 43 3/4 in. (87.9 x 111.1 cm)
Signed, dated and numbered 24/36, additionally annotated '36' in pencil (there were also 10 artist's proofs), published by Gemini G.E.L., Los Angeles (with their and the artist's blindstamps), unframed.

Auction result well in line with expectations
In October this year Phillips in New York held the auction Editions & Works on Paper, which included the work Hreppholar V (G. 1554, B-W. 78) by Richard Serra. The price achieved of USD 10,795.00 (€ 10,214.80) was within expectations - the estimate range had previously been set by the auction house as USD 8,000.00 – 12,000.00. Of course, this price has nothing to do with the top prices that other works by Richard Serra achieve. The highest price we have observed so far was reached by the work L.A. Cone in May 2013 with an auction result of USD 4,267,750.00 (€ 3,285,917.77).
